What is the name of ‘h’ in given equation, if difference of energy E between the higher energy state E2 and the lower energy state E1? E = E2 - E1 = h Correct Answer Planck’s constant
- Electrons can jump from one energy level to another, but they can never have orbits with energies other than the allowed energy levels.
- The difference of energy E between the higher energy E2 and the lower energy state E1 given by:
Eg = hc/λ
Where Eg is the energy of photon (in eV)
h is Planck's constant (4.14 × 10-15 eV /s)
c is the speed of the light ( 3 × 108 m/s)
